site stats

Creating cursor in sql

WebApr 12, 2024 · SQL : How can I create a cursor from xml nodes in a stored procedure in SQL Server?To Access My Live Chat Page, On Google, Search for "hows tech developer co... WebThe cursor is defined with a name, optionally a list of parameters, and an SQL SELECT statement. The cursor provides the functionality to iterate through a query result row-by-row. Updating cursors is not supported. Note Avoid using cursors when it is possible to express the same logic with SQL. You should do this as cursors cannot be optimized ...

What is Cursor in SQL - GeeksforGeeks

Webyou cannot reference a cursor variable in a cursor FOR loop. but you can use the select statment direct: create or replace PROCEDURE myprocedure AS LV_TEST_CUR SYS_REFCURSOR; LV_QUERY VARCHAR2 (200); LV_DATE DATE; BEGIN FOR CUR_VAR IN (select sysdate as mydate from dual) LOOP dbms_output.put_line … WebOpening a PL/SQL Cursor After declaring a cursor, you can open it by using the following syntax: OPEN cursor_name [ ( argument_1 [, argument_2 ...] ) ]; Code language: SQL (Structured Query Language) (sql) You have to specify the cursor’s name cursor_name after the keyword OPEN. mott\\u0027s inc https://thriftydeliveryservice.com

Working with cursors and dynamic queries in PL/SQL - Oracle

WebFeb 18, 2024 · The cursor is created for the ‘SELECT’ statement that is given in the cursor declaration. In execution part, the declared cursor is opened, fetched and closed. Cursor Attributes Both Implicit cursor and … WebDec 31, 2024 · Creating a SQL Server cursor is a consistent process. steps you are easily able to duplicate them with various sets of logic to loop Let's walk through the steps: … mott\\u0027s mango peach applesauce

sql - How to insert records in a existing table using Cursor - Stack ...

Category:PL/SQL Package - PL/SQL Tutorial

Tags:Creating cursor in sql

Creating cursor in sql

Mujtaba Mohammed - Power BI / SQL Developer - Verisk LinkedIn

WebCreate an another Procedure and write the code of cursor in this new procedure and then call the procedure from where u want to declare a cursor... It's not allowed a DEFINE cur CURSOR FOR prepared_statement, you must define a valid SQL statement. The good news is that you can define the cursor on a view that can be dynamically created later. WebFeb 8, 2024 · I copy below the sample code. First create the procedure. CREATE PROCEDURE dbo.uspCurrencyCursor @CurrencyCursor CURSOR VARYING OUTPUT AS SET NOCOUNT ON; SET @CurrencyCursor = CURSOR FORWARD_ONLY STATIC FOR SELECT CurrencyCode, Name FROM Sales.Currency; OPEN @CurrencyCursor; …

Creating cursor in sql

Did you know?

Web• Hands on experience with SQL programming and Transact-SQL in creating tables, Stored Procedures, triggers, cursors, user-defined functions, views, indexes, user profiles, relational database ... WebSep 5, 2024 · How to create Explicit Cursor: Declare Cursor Object. Syntax : DECLARE cursor_name CURSOR FOR SELECT * FROM table_name DECLARE s1 CURSOR …

WebJul 1, 2024 · One way of doing this is to get the records to be processed first into a temp table, not the original table, but a cursor that will use the records in the temp table. When this path is used, it is assumed that the number of records in the temp table has been greatly reduced compared to the original table. WebThe MySQLCursor of mysql-connector-python (and similar libraries) is used to execute statements to communicate with the MySQL database. Using the methods of it you can execute SQL statements, fetch data from the result sets, call procedures. You can create Cursor object using the cursor () method of the Connection object/class.

WebSep 26, 2024 · The Four Steps in an SQL Cursor There are four steps in the lifecycle of a cursor: Declare The Declare step of a cursor is where you specify the name of the cursor and the SQL statement that is used to … WebMar 13, 2024 · FOR READ ONLY END ELSE BEGIN DECLARE YourCursor CURSOR FOR SELECT ColumnB FROM YourTable WHERE ... FOR READ ONLY END --populate and allocate resources to the cursor OPEN YourCursor --process each row WHILE 1=1 BEGIN FETCH NEXT FROM YourCursor INTO @FetchColumn --finished fetching all rows?

WebCreating PL/SQL Package Body PL/SQL package body contains all the code that implements stored functions, procedures, and cursors listed in the package specification. The following illustrates the syntax of creating package body: CREATE [ OR REPLACE] PACKAGE BODY package_name { IS AS } Code language: SQL (Structured Query …

WebSQL Cursor Functions - In SQL Server, a cursor is a database object that enables us to retrieve and modify data from individual rows one at a time. Nothing more than a row pointer is what a cursor actually is. It always goes together with a SELECT statement. Typically, it consists of a set of SQL statements that iterate t mott\u0027s medley assorted fruit flavored snacksWebJul 17, 2024 · There are four steps in using an Explicit Cursor. DECLARE the cursor in the Declaration section. OPEN the cursor in the Execution Section. FETCH the data from the cursor into PL/SQL variables or records in the Execution Section. CLOSE the cursor in the Execution Section before you end the PL/SQL Block. Syntax: healthy savings ucare otcWebSep 27, 2024 · Steps to create and use a Cursor. 1.Declaring Cursor : A cursor is declared for defining SQL statements. We have declared a cursor as EmployeeCursor … healthy savings ucare phone numberWebApr 18, 2024 · DECLARE cur TYPES.CURSOR_TYPE; p_id PER_NAMES.ID%TYPE; p_name PER_NAMES.NAME%TYPE; BEGIN PCK_FIRST.get_getnames ( 1, cur ); LOOP FETCH cur INTO p_id, p_name; EXIT WHEN cur%NOTFOUND; DBMS_OUTPUT.PUT_LINE ( p_id ': ' p_name ); END LOOP; CLOSE cur; END; / … healthysavingsuhc.comWebJul 27, 2024 · It's worth noting that you could declare the cursor explicitly and then reference the cursor name in the for, like so: declare cursor my_cur as ...; begin for my_rec in my_cur loop ..., if you wanted to. – Boneist Jul 27, 2024 at 10:56 healthy savings ucare catalogWebJan 14, 2024 · Declare Cursor Before using a cursor, you first must declare the cursor. So, in this section, we will declare variables and restore an arrangement of values. Open … healthy savings ucare food listWebThe syntax for creating an explicit cursor is − CURSOR cursor_name IS select_statement; Working with an explicit cursor includes the following steps − Declaring the cursor for … mott\u0027s medley assorted fruit snacks